Agent De Service Hospitalier
The Hospital Service Agent (ASH) contributes to the well-being, comfort, and quality of life of residents in nursing homes and long-term care facilities. Integrated into a multidisciplinary team, they participate in the maintenance of premises, the support of residents in daily life activities, and the quality of their environment.
In collaboration with nursing assistants, nurses, and all professionals in the establishment, the ASH ensures to offer a pleasant, safe, and respectful living environment for each resident. They also participate in the implementation of the Personalized Resident Project (PPR) and contribute to the prevention of infections associated with care.
